Each year, 200+ members of the Health Care for the Homeless community board buses and travel to Annapolis to educate lawmakers on issues of poverty and homelessness, and to advocate for laws that support health care, housing and livable incomes for all. Join us on Thursday, February 25 at 421 Fallsway at 7 a.m. For more information, contact our Director of Community Relations Adam Schneider at aschneider@hchmd.org or 443-703-1398.
